HTLV Tax gene expression in patients with lymphoproliferative disorders

Aims:
To study the expression of the human T lymphotropic virus (HTLV) Tax gene in peripheral blood mononuclear cells.
Methods:
Blood was collected from 72 patients with lymphoproliferative disorders. Serum from all patients was assayed for antibodies directed against HTLV-I structural proteins by ELISA and western blotting. RNA was purified from fresh blood cells and amplified by reverse transcription polymerase chain reaction (RT-PCR). After Southern blotting, the PCR products were hybridised with a 32P end-labelled probe specific for the Tax gene.
Results:
All samples were seronegative. A specific band for the Tax gene was found in five samples. Each of the patients positive for Tax gene expression had a different type of lymphoproliferative disorder.
Conclusions:
Infection by HTLV-I cannot be assessed solely by immunological assays, particularly when only disrupted virions are used. Sensitive molecular biology assays are essential for detecting viral gene expression in fresh blood cells.
